  • Applications

    Gramine (CAS 87-52-5) is an indole-based alkaloid bearing a dimethylaminomethyl group, commonly regarded as an intermediate and building block for the synthesis of indole-containing compounds in pharmaceutical research and specialty chemicals; in the fragrance industry, the compound or its derivatives may be explored as an odorant precursor or as a contributor to indole-type aroma notes; in cosmetics and personal care, it may be considered as a fragrance component or synthesis precursor for formulations of scented products; in industrial manufacturing, gramine is studied as a starting material for indole-based molecules and related specialty chemicals.
